ATI Introduces The New MOBILITY FIRE GL 9000 Visual Processor for Mobile Workstation MARKHAM, Ontario, Sep 23, 2002 (BUSINESS WIRE) -- ATI Technologies, Inc., (ATYT)(ATY) today announced the MOBILITY(TM) FIRE GL(TM) 9000 visual processor for mobile workstation, based on ATI's ground-breaking MOBILITY(TM) RADEON(TM) 9000 visual processor. Designed for advanced CAD/CAM and digital content creation (DCC), the MOBILITY FIRE GL 9000 delivers exceptional performance, flexibility and value. Hailed by CAD/CAM and DCC application providers, the MOBILITY FIRE GL 9000 offers design professionals stable workstation-class graphics performance on a mobile platform and optimized OpenGL(R) drivers for lightning fast 3D and 2D graphics. With four parallel rendering pipelines and up to 64MB of 128-bit DDR on-board integrated memory, the MOBILITY FIRE GL 9000 delivers groundbreaking performance to power leading DCC and CAD software applications. "The MOBILITY FIRE GL 9000 delivers desktop workstation performance combined with the flexibility of version 1.4 pixel shader support and unparalleled power management," said Phil Eisler, Vice President and General Manager, Mobile and Integrated Business Unit, ATI Technologies, Inc. "With its raw power, rendering flexibility and anytime, anywhere mobility, it is the perfect solution for demanding digital artists, developers and engineers who envision, design and create while on the move." The MOBILITY FIRE GL 9000 is backed by ATI's FIRE GL development team, a dedicated group of workstation software and hardware engineers who work closely with ATI customers and deliver fully optimized high-performance drivers. The MOBILITY FIRE GL 9000 provides users with software driver options for the most popular workstation operating environments including Windows 2000(R)/Windows NT(R) and Linux with fully optimized OpenGL(R) custom extensions. ATI Technologies Inc. is a world leader in the design and manufacture of innovative 3D graphics and digital media silicon solutions. An industry pioneer since 1985, ATI delivers leading-edge performance solutions for the full range of PC and Mac desktop and notebook platforms, workstation, set-top box, game console and handheld markets. With 2001 revenues in excess of US $1 billion, ATI has more than 1,900 employees in the Americas, Europe and Asia. ATI common shares trade on NASDAQ (ATYT) and the Toronto Stock Exchange (ATY).
